WWE‘s plans for Brock Lesnar at August 23’s SummerSlam pay-per-view event may have been revealed according to a new report.
Sportskeeda’s Tom Colohue reports that Lesnar is pencilled in to challenge Drew McIntyre for the WWE Championship, despite talk that McIntyre could be set for a match against Randy Orton.
Colohue said:
“There has been a lot of talk recently, a lot of it by Drew McIntyre himself as to whether or not Randy Orton could be the challenger come SummerSlam. The expectation is that the main event will be Brock Lesnar in a rematch against Drew McIntyre at Summerslam. That is what is pencilled in at the moment.”
McIntyre defends his title against Dolph Ziggler at the upcoming July 19 Extreme Rules pay-per-view, with a clear lack of credible challengers available due to WWE’s booking.
The Scot first won the title by beating Lesnar at WrestleMania in April, with Lesnar having held it since the SmackDown FOX debut in October.
